Achieving eLearning Localization Mastery: Top Strategies
E-learning adaptation is essential for reaching a global audience and maximizing the impact of your training programs. Successfully integrating e-learning localization involves careful planning, execution, and ongoing assessment. To ensure impact, follow these best practices:
* Perform comprehensive market research to understand the target audience's cultural nuances, language preferences, and learning styles.
* Select professional localization specialists with expertise in both the source and target languages.
* Prioritize linguistic accuracy and cultural sensitivity throughout the adaptation process.
* Review localized content rigorously to ensure it is clear, concise, and engaging for the target learners.
* Embed feedback from learners and subject matter experts to continuously improve the localized e-learning content.
By embracing these best practices, you can create high-quality, culturally relevant e-learning experiences that connect with learners worldwide.

Building Compelling eLearning Experiences: Localization Strategies for Diverse Learners
Effective eLearning experiences ought to resonate with learners from various cultural backgrounds and linguistic abilities. To achieve this, localization strategies are essential.
Localization involves adapting your eLearning content to address the specific needs of a target group. This can encompass translating text into different languages, but it also encompasses tailoring visuals, audio, and even the overall learning design to be culturally appropriate.
By utilizing effective localization strategies, you can create eLearning experiences that are accessible for a wider range of learners. This enables a more impactful learning journey and ultimately contributes the overall effectiveness of your eLearning programs.
